What is the Enterprise-Class Transformation Leadership course about?
Even experienced leaders struggle to scale change when governance, risk, and legacy systems intersect. Traditional project management and agile frameworks fall short when board-level scrutiny, audit trails, and cross-functional dependencies dominate the landscape. Without a structured approach, initiatives stall, lose funding, or deliver partial value.
